What is Tiki?

Tiki is an event management platform developed by the Computer Science Chapter at KTH. It is designed to be used for both internal and public events, and is built from the ground up to be flexible and easy to use.

The Computer Science Chapter at KTH has for a long time had issues with event management, and particularly with ticket releases. None of the existing solutions on the market were flexible enough for our needs, and we needed something that could be adapted to our own specific needs. So, we decided to build our own event managment platform, with built-in ticket releases and direct payments using multiple payment providers. The result from more than two years of development is Tiki, our own event management platform. It has been developed from scratch by passionate KTH students, with the main efforts lead by Adrian Salamon.

  • Flexible. Tiki is designed to be flexible and easy to use. It is built from the ground based on the needs of the Computer Science Chapter.
  • Scalable. Tiki is built from the ground up to be scalable and performant. By building on the scalable Elixir/BEAM platform, we can use realtime features while remaining performant.
  • Cost effective. By integrating directly with payment providers, the chapter saves money by eliminating needless fees.
  • Open. Tiki is source-available software, licensed under the Source First License. You can modify and use the software for your own purposes. Check it out at GitHub!

Frequently asked questions

How are payments handled?
Two payments methods are currently supported: Stripe and Swish. Both methods are securely handled by the respective payment providers. In order to use Swish, you need to be connected to a swedish bank that supports BankId and Swish. We support Stripe payments via credit/debit cards from all major card vendors. No money is handled internally by Tiki.
Do I need to have an account to use Tiki?
No. You can purchase a ticket and recieve it on any valid email address. If you register for an account, you can log in and see your previous purchases, but this is not required.
Do I need to bring a ticket to an event?
No. You can show your digital ticket, including a QR code, when you show up to an event. You can find your ticket either from your order confirmation confirmation email, or via the "Your Tickets" page when logged in on the Tiki website.
